Scared of Shots: Play Therapy and Coping with Medical Anxiety, presents considerations in helping children with medical anxiety.

Equipping parents in supporting their child’s emotional and developmental needs may be the most important role play therapists have in an effort towards lasting change. The medical environment creates anxiety for children and parents alike. Therefore, empowering parents in their relationships with their children is of significant value.
